The station might not have its own ticket office or ticket machine on site, but travelers can collect their tickets at the nearby ticket office, making travel planning a breeze.
Liverpool James Street station offers several amenities despite the absence of a dedicated ticket office and collection points for tickets purchased online. The station ensures accessibility with step-free routes to all platforms, effectively catering to those with mobility needs. Elevators whisk passengers from James Street to the platforms, classifying the station under Category A for accessibility. Additionally, seating areas are available for those waiting for their train.
For those who need information or assistance during their travels, the station extends customer support through staff presence at specific times. From early morning till late at night, help points are available to inform travelers of departure, arrival, and transit options. At Liverpool James Street, induction loops for the hearing impaired and secure ticket barriers streamline passenger movement yet bolster safety.
While the station does not host an array of shops or extensive refreshment services onsite, nearby facilities in Liverpool One are open to cater to shopping and dining desires. Travelers should note the lack of luggage storage and secure bicycle storage, although CCTV monitoring is active ensuring the safety and security of the premises.

Styal station, part of the Northern Line network, offers basic facilities designed to meet essential needs. While you won't find a ticket office here, the station does provide ticket machines where passengers can both purchase and collect pre-purchased tickets. It's worth noting, however, that these machines are not currently accessible for wheelchair users. Though there is no staff on hand for assistance, an induction loop is available for hearing aid users and there's also a telephone helpline for additional support.
When it comes to accessibility, Styal provides step-free access to certain parts of the station. There's a long sloping path from the road overbridge to the Manchester platform and step-free access from the car park to the Crewe platform. However, amenities such as accessible toilets, along with waiting rooms, and staff assistance are not available. If you require assistance, you can plan your travels using the Passenger Assist service, which is available to book ahead of time. Styal station is categorized as a Category B station, suitable for scooter users but not entirely barrier-free.
Beyond trains, Styal station offers some convenient travel links. For those looking at alternative travel options, a rail replacement service is available with pick-up/drop-off on Station Road near the car park entrance. If you prefer traveling by taxi, services can be booked through the Cab4You service. Although bicycle hire isn't available directly at the station, bike storage is provided, ensuring cyclists have the opportunity to park their bicycles safely. Local bus services can be easily reached, adding another layer of connectivity for passengers venturing beyond the station.
